Srinagar : Tuesday, 05 Jun 2018 . Lt Gen Ranbir Singh, GOC-in-C Northern Command visited the forward posts at Siachen Glacier “ the highest Battlefield in the world” today . The Army Commander was briefed on the operational preparedness and the current situation. The GOC-in-C interacted with troops at the Siachen Base Camp and complimented the tenacious resolve, unstinting commitment of the ‘Siachen Warriors’ deployed in extreme harsh weather and inhospitable terrain.
